Transaction a342533da20acf8a1719370eaf76a4b1d3e8c85aa5b70c509098c52dcb1cef66

77 Input
1 Outputs
  • a342533da20acf8a1719370eaf76a4b1d3e8c85aa5b70c509098c52dcb1cef66:0
  • value  1310338520
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h